Sulfuric Acid Market Size, Trends, and Strategic Outlook 2025-2032
The Sulfuric Acid market remains a critical component within the chemical manufacturing industry, functioning as a key raw material across various sectors including fertilizers, pharmaceuticals, and mining. Advancements in production technologies and increasing demand from emerging economies continue to drive significant shifts in industry trends and market dynamics. Market Size and Overview
The Global Sulfuric Acid Market size is estimated to be valued at USD 3,971.0 Mn in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 6,116.8 Mn by 2032,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.8% from 2025 to 2032.
The Sulfuric Acid Market Growth highlights an expanding market scope driven by intensified industrialization and growing applications in metal processing and chemical synthesis. Market insights further indicate consistent growth in market revenue fueled by rising end-user demand and innovations improving production efficiency.
Impact of Geopolitical Situation on Supply Chain
A notable case is the disruption in sulfur raw material supply caused by geopolitical tensions in Eastern Europe in 2024, where mining operations supplying key materials to the sulfuric acid market were temporarily halted. This led to a 15% decrease in sulfur availability globally, compelling market players to diversify their suppliers and accelerate investments in alternative raw material sourcing. The resultant supply chain realignment impacted market growth negatively in the short term but fostered resilience and innovation-focused supply strategies that promise stabilized market size and revenue in the medium term. Sulfuric acid has the molecular formula 'H2SO4.' It's classified as a strong mineral acid with high corrosive properties. Sulfuric acid is a viscous liquid that is soluble in water and varies in colour from yellow to colourless depending on concentration. Hydrochloric acid, nitric acid, sulphate salts, synthetic detergents, dyes, pigments, explosives, and drugs are all made from sulfuric acid. The Complete Guide To Sulfuric Acid
Sulfuric acid is an oily, colourless liquid. With the release of heat, it is soluble in water. It corrodes metals and tissue. It will char wood and most other organic matter when it comes into contact with it, but it is unlikely to start a fire. Density: 15 pound per gallon Long-term exposure to low concentrations or short-term exposure to high concentrations can have negative health effects when inhaled. It is used in the production of fertilisers and other chemicals, the refining of petroleum, the production of iron and steel, and a variety of other applications.
Sulfuric acid has the potential to cause severe burns, especially at high concentrations. When it comes into contact with living tissues, such as skin and flesh, it decomposes proteins and lipids via amide and ester hydrolysis, just like other corrosive acids and alkalis. Furthermore, it has a strong dehydrating effect on carbohydrates, releasing extra heat and causing secondary thermal burns. As a result, it attacks the cornea quickly and can cause permanent blindness if splashed into the eyes. If ingested, it causes irreversible damage to internal organs and may even be fatal. When handling it, protective equipment should always be used. Furthermore, because of its strong oxidising property, it is highly corrosive to many metals and may extend its decomposition to other materials.

Sulfuric Acid Market Emerging Trend, Company Demand and Regional Analysis by 2019 - 2027
The chemical formula for sulfuric acid is H2SO4. It's a corrosive mineral acid with a strong corrosive potential, according to the classification. Sulfuric acid is a viscous, water-soluble liquid that ranges in colour from yellow to colourless depending on concentration. Sulfuric acid is used to make commercially important substances such hydrochloric acid, nitric acid, sulphate salts, synthetic detergents, dyes, pigments, explosives, and medicines.
Rapid industrialization and urbanisation are reducing arable land, forcing farmers to utilise fertilisers to boost agricultural productivity. The increasing use of H2SO4 in the creation of high-quality fertilisers for agricultural purposes is expected to accelerate Sulfuric Acid Market growth. The manufacture of polluted sulfuric acid in petroleum and chemical refineries is mostly responsible for the regeneration of pure and concentrated H2SO4 products. Low emissions from regenerated acids result in lower manufacturing costs, making it more sustainable and environmentally friendly. Increasing investments in the chemical manufacturing sector's developmental activities linked to chemical synthesis are expected to drive market expansion over the forecast period.
